Summary
Overview
Work History
Education
Skills
Projects
Websites
Timeline
Generic

RAHI SHAH

Summary

Dynamic software development leader with extensive experience at AMD India Pvt. Ltd., driving automation and validation initiatives. Expert in cloud infrastructure and DevOps practices, I championed the rollout of a unified automation platform, enhancing engineering productivity and collaboration. Proven ability to influence architectural decisions while fostering cross-team synergy.

Overview

13
13
years of professional experience

Work History

Manager & MTS Software Development Engineer

AMD India Pvt. Ltd.
Remde
08.2021 - Current
  • Lead a cross-functional team of 6 engineers while driving strategic initiatives to modernize and scale AMD’s post-silicon validation automation across 12+ global validation teams.
  • Drove enterprise-wide adoption of Prism, AMD’s unified automation platform, enabling consistent, reusable, and scalable execution of 10,000+ test runs daily across server validation domains.
  • Served as the technical lead and primary architect for key infrastructure decisions, influencing architectural direction, tooling standardization, and best practices across teams.
  • Architected and delivered core components of Prism, including the Scheduler and Executor, laying the foundation for seamless task orchestration and accelerating time-to-validation.
  • Championed the successful rollout of Prism to 200+ engineers, significantly improving automation reliability, platform coverage, and engineering productivity.
  • Formulated and led the migration to Azure Cloud, delivering a resilient, cost-optimized cloud-native solution that optimized flexibility and trimmed failure recovery time by ~40%.
  • Leveraged Azure Event Hub to handle millions of queued tasks/months with real-time event processing.
  • Provisioned automation services via Azure Kubernetes Service (AKS) for containerized scalability.
  • Implemented Azure Blob Storage for efficient management of terabytes of logs, artifacts, and configuration data.
  • Operationalized infrastructure-as-code and CI/CD pipelines in partnership with DevOps, reducing provisioning time by 60% and ensuring consistent, reliable deployments.
  • Spearheaded the design and delivery of “ATEST”, a next-gen Python-based automation framework.
  • Addressed critical pain points such as environment portability and failure traceability.
  • Set to replace legacy systems across 8 validation teams (~150+ engineers), with an expected 50% reduction in maintenance overhead.
  • Fostered cross-team collaboration by aligning diverse validation teams on automation best practices, accelerating feature rollouts and maximizing resource efficiency.

System Validation Engineer

Intel Corporation
Oregon
03.2018 - 07.2021
  • Outlined scalable Python-based automation for Xeon and Optane post-silicon validation, supporting 120+ engineers across 8 teams.
  • Led automation for 3 generations of Intel Xeon processors and Optane memory, increasing validation throughput by 70%.
  • Re-architected tools for project-independence using config-driven design, multithreading, and modular deployment.
  • Engineered automated triage tool that lowered debug time and auto-filed bug reports for new failures.
  • Represented validation in cross-functional planning, driving 30% efficiency gains and resolving 10 customer escape bugs.
  • Mentored interns and new hires on automation strategy and best practices.
  • Represented the automation team in organization wide strategy discussions, aligning execution workflows across validation, debug, and triage teams.

Software Test Engineer

Intel Corporation
Oregon
05.2017 - 03.2018
  • Programmed test framework (Perl, Python, Selenium, C/C++) that brought down test time by 30% and enhanced repeatability.
  • Automated validation of Intel’s AI-enabled wireless smart router across diverse environments and releases.
  • Wrote and maintained API unit tests and Selenium-based functional test cases.

Software Engineer Intern

Intel Corporation
Oregon
01.2016 - 12.2016
  • Wrote C++ logic for seamless voice call handoff between Wi-Fi and Cellular based on signal strength (RSSI).
  • Automated tests using Jenkins, Google Test, and Perl; integrated with CI pipelines for regression coverage.
  • Authored and executed functional and end-to-end test cases.

Software Developer

Indian Space Research Organization
09.2012 - 11.2014
  • Deployed an interactive Java-based image processing tool with zoom, crop, and RGB scan features.
  • Boosted image quality by 50% and minimized processing time by half.
  • Designed JSP/Servlet-based web app for daily report viewing and downloads.
  • Delivered 4 full-stack web apps with focus on cross-browser compatibility and UX.

Education

Master of Science (M.S.) - Computer Science

IIT
Chicago, USA
05.2017

Bachelor of Engineering (B.E.) - Computer Engineering

GTU
INDIA
05.2012

Skills

  • Automation and validation
  • Distributed systems
  • Parallel programming
  • Virtualization technologies
  • Cloud infrastructure
  • API architecture
  • Test-driven development
  • Data mining and visualization
  • Programming languages and frameworks
  • Cloud services and tools
  • DevOps practices and tooling
  • Operating systems expertise
  • Database management and storage solutions
  • Security protocols and access control

Projects

Illinois Institute of Technology, Chicago, Advanced Web Applications – Online Shopping Portal, Developed a full-stack e-commerce web application using React (frontend), Spring Boot (backend), and PostgreSQL (database)., Gujarat Technological University, India, Web Applications – Online Auction Website, Built a JSP-Servlet-based auction system using MySQL, demonstrating MVC architecture and real-time bidding logic.

Timeline

Manager & MTS Software Development Engineer

AMD India Pvt. Ltd.
08.2021 - Current

System Validation Engineer

Intel Corporation
03.2018 - 07.2021

Software Test Engineer

Intel Corporation
05.2017 - 03.2018

Software Engineer Intern

Intel Corporation
01.2016 - 12.2016

Software Developer

Indian Space Research Organization
09.2012 - 11.2014

Master of Science (M.S.) - Computer Science

IIT

Bachelor of Engineering (B.E.) - Computer Engineering

GTU
RAHI SHAH